Rooftop farming is gaining popularity for growing organic vegetables with minimal water use, but is highly vulnerable to pest infestation, and urban residents new to farming often fail to notice pest attacks. Noting that existing image-processing and machine-learning pest identification systems are typically disease-specific with low generalization accuracy and poor usability, this paper proposes a mobile-based pest identification system built on a pretrained convolutional neural network model (AlexNet). Various rooftop pests were evaluated experimentally using different kernel sizes and layer configurations, and the best-performing pretrained model was converted into a mobile application via a REST API to provide pesticide recommendations to novice users.
